SlideShare a Scribd company logo
USING THE WORDPRESS CUSTOMIZER
/JOSHUA KIDD @G33K_KIDD
ABOUT ME - JOSHUA KIDD
Web Developer for 8 Years
Developer at
Mainly focused on JavaScript Frameworks, WordPress,
Ruby, and Go
Folsom Creative
WHAT IS THE CUSTOMIZER?
Visual editor and live-view for WordPress
WHY THE CUSTOMIZER?
Flexibility for the user
Simple for front-end users
PARTS OF THE CUSTOMIZER
Settings
Panels
Sections
Controls
SETTINGS
The settings API allows you to create reusable settings that
are changed and used by the customizer.
THEME_MOD VS OPTION
theme_mod: Current theme only.
option: Global setting.
EXAMPLES
$wp_customize->add_setting('social_media_twitter_setting', array(
'default' => '@g33k_kidd', // default value
'type' => 'option', // theme_mod or option
'transport' => 'refresh' // how it updates
));
$wp_customize->add_setting('background_color', array(
'default' => '#FFFFFF', // default value
'type' => 'theme_mod', // theme_mod or option
'transport' => 'refresh' // how it updates
));
PANELS
New since 4.0
Used for grouping sections.
EXAMPLE
$wp_customize->add_panel('options_panel', array(
'title' => 'Example Panel',
'description' => 'Description',
'priority' => 10
));
SECTIONS
Used for grouping controls.
EXAMPLE
$wp_customize->add_section('social_media_section', array(
'title' => 'Example Panel',
'theme_supports' => '',
'capability' => 'edit_theme_options',
'description' => 'Description',
'panel' => 'options_panel',
'priority' => 10
));
CONTROLS
DEFAULT CONTROLS
Plain Text
Color Picker
Image Select/Upload
Background Image (not documented)
Header Image (not documented)
EXAMPLE
$wp_customize->add_control('social_media_twitter', array(
'label' => 'Twitter Profile',
'description' => 'Enter your twitter username or url here.',
'settings' => 'social_media_twitter_setting',
'priority' => 10,
'section' => 'social_media_section',
'type' => 'text'
));
EXAMPLES/READING
http://kirki.org/
Make Theme
Customizer Guide
DEMO TIME
QUESTIONS?
GET IN TOUCH
Website: g33kidd.com
Folsom: folsomcreative.com
Twitter: @g33k_kidd
Github: @g33kidd

More Related Content

PPTX
Sikkim Tourism
ODP
Developing html skills 1
PPTX
Improving joomla's backend user experience
PPT
CMS 101 Drupal
PPT
Joomla tutorial
PPTX
Who is she in tunis advanced webmaster administration session
TXT
Jampa X-Treme
PPT
Joomla beginners guide
Sikkim Tourism
Developing html skills 1
Improving joomla's backend user experience
CMS 101 Drupal
Joomla tutorial
Who is she in tunis advanced webmaster administration session
Jampa X-Treme
Joomla beginners guide

Viewers also liked (20)

PDF
Catalogo Le Isole 2013 - Imperatore Travel
PDF
Catalogo Puglia Calabria Basilicata 2013 - Imperatore Travel
PDF
Company Profile Imperatore Travel
PPTX
Customizer in WordPress
PDF
WordPress Customizer
PDF
Catalogo Le Isole 2015 | Imperatore Travel
PDF
Catalogo Campania 2015 | Imperatore Travel
PDF
Catalogo Sicilia 2015 | Imperatore Travel
PDF
Small Business Guide to Content Strategy
PPTX
WordPress customizer for themes and more
PDF
WordPress Theme Basics
PPT
Glass fibers composite manufacturing processes
PPTX
Drying final
PDF
Catalogo Isole 2014 | Imperatore Travel
PPTX
Fsktes
PDF
Catalogo Campania 2013 - Imperatore Travel
PDF
Catalogo Sardegna-Corsica 2013 - Imperatore Travel
PPTX
Nya rektorer 2012 08-09
PDF
Catalogo Sicilia 2013 - Imperatore Travel
PPTX
Torpet
Catalogo Le Isole 2013 - Imperatore Travel
Catalogo Puglia Calabria Basilicata 2013 - Imperatore Travel
Company Profile Imperatore Travel
Customizer in WordPress
WordPress Customizer
Catalogo Le Isole 2015 | Imperatore Travel
Catalogo Campania 2015 | Imperatore Travel
Catalogo Sicilia 2015 | Imperatore Travel
Small Business Guide to Content Strategy
WordPress customizer for themes and more
WordPress Theme Basics
Glass fibers composite manufacturing processes
Drying final
Catalogo Isole 2014 | Imperatore Travel
Fsktes
Catalogo Campania 2013 - Imperatore Travel
Catalogo Sardegna-Corsica 2013 - Imperatore Travel
Nya rektorer 2012 08-09
Catalogo Sicilia 2013 - Imperatore Travel
Torpet
Ad

Similar to Using The WordPress Customizer (20)

PDF
Image manipulation in WordPress 3.5
PPTX
Simple module Development in Joomla! 2.5
ODP
Accessibility & WordPress: Developing for the whole world.
PDF
Going web native
PPTX
Introduction to Plugin Programming, WordCamp Miami 2011
PPTX
Providing the ultimate publishing experience
PDF
WordCamp Praga 2015
DOC
Embedded UA 101 - STC Summit 2013, Scott DeLoach, ClickStart
ODP
WordPress Accessibility: WordCamp Chicago
PDF
Front End Development for Back End Developers - Denver Startup Week 2017
PDF
WordPress - Visual Composer - Beyond beginning
PDF
Opencast Admin UI - Introduction to developing using AngularJS
PPTX
AngularJS On-Ramp
PDF
Modular Test-driven SPAs with Spring and AngularJS
PPTX
WordPress 3.0 at DC PHP
PPT
WordPress basic fundamental of plugin development and creating shortcode
PPTX
10 Things Every Plugin Developer Should Know (WordCamp Atlanta 2013)
PDF
Image Manipulation in WordPress 3.5 - WordCamp Phoenix 2013
PDF
Django Vs Rails
PPTX
Getting Started With WordPress Development
Image manipulation in WordPress 3.5
Simple module Development in Joomla! 2.5
Accessibility & WordPress: Developing for the whole world.
Going web native
Introduction to Plugin Programming, WordCamp Miami 2011
Providing the ultimate publishing experience
WordCamp Praga 2015
Embedded UA 101 - STC Summit 2013, Scott DeLoach, ClickStart
WordPress Accessibility: WordCamp Chicago
Front End Development for Back End Developers - Denver Startup Week 2017
WordPress - Visual Composer - Beyond beginning
Opencast Admin UI - Introduction to developing using AngularJS
AngularJS On-Ramp
Modular Test-driven SPAs with Spring and AngularJS
WordPress 3.0 at DC PHP
WordPress basic fundamental of plugin development and creating shortcode
10 Things Every Plugin Developer Should Know (WordCamp Atlanta 2013)
Image Manipulation in WordPress 3.5 - WordCamp Phoenix 2013
Django Vs Rails
Getting Started With WordPress Development
Ad

Recently uploaded (20)

PDF
Approach and Philosophy of On baking technology
PDF
How UI/UX Design Impacts User Retention in Mobile Apps.pdf
PDF
Blue Purple Modern Animated Computer Science Presentation.pdf.pdf
PDF
The Rise and Fall of 3GPP – Time for a Sabbatical?
PDF
Peak of Data & AI Encore- AI for Metadata and Smarter Workflows
PDF
Electronic commerce courselecture one. Pdf
PDF
Advanced methodologies resolving dimensionality complications for autism neur...
PDF
Build a system with the filesystem maintained by OSTree @ COSCUP 2025
PDF
Per capita expenditure prediction using model stacking based on satellite ima...
PDF
Encapsulation_ Review paper, used for researhc scholars
PPTX
Effective Security Operations Center (SOC) A Modern, Strategic, and Threat-In...
PDF
Network Security Unit 5.pdf for BCA BBA.
PPTX
Understanding_Digital_Forensics_Presentation.pptx
PDF
7 ChatGPT Prompts to Help You Define Your Ideal Customer Profile.pdf
PDF
Agricultural_Statistics_at_a_Glance_2022_0.pdf
PPTX
VMware vSphere Foundation How to Sell Presentation-Ver1.4-2-14-2024.pptx
PDF
Bridging biosciences and deep learning for revolutionary discoveries: a compr...
PDF
Machine learning based COVID-19 study performance prediction
PDF
NewMind AI Weekly Chronicles - August'25 Week I
PDF
KodekX | Application Modernization Development
Approach and Philosophy of On baking technology
How UI/UX Design Impacts User Retention in Mobile Apps.pdf
Blue Purple Modern Animated Computer Science Presentation.pdf.pdf
The Rise and Fall of 3GPP – Time for a Sabbatical?
Peak of Data & AI Encore- AI for Metadata and Smarter Workflows
Electronic commerce courselecture one. Pdf
Advanced methodologies resolving dimensionality complications for autism neur...
Build a system with the filesystem maintained by OSTree @ COSCUP 2025
Per capita expenditure prediction using model stacking based on satellite ima...
Encapsulation_ Review paper, used for researhc scholars
Effective Security Operations Center (SOC) A Modern, Strategic, and Threat-In...
Network Security Unit 5.pdf for BCA BBA.
Understanding_Digital_Forensics_Presentation.pptx
7 ChatGPT Prompts to Help You Define Your Ideal Customer Profile.pdf
Agricultural_Statistics_at_a_Glance_2022_0.pdf
VMware vSphere Foundation How to Sell Presentation-Ver1.4-2-14-2024.pptx
Bridging biosciences and deep learning for revolutionary discoveries: a compr...
Machine learning based COVID-19 study performance prediction
NewMind AI Weekly Chronicles - August'25 Week I
KodekX | Application Modernization Development

Using The WordPress Customizer